Montreal-based production duo Banx & Ranx fuse reggae and broader Caribbean elements into an emphatically dancefloor-oriented aesthetic. Their breakthrough arrived via the 2018 U.K. Top Five single “Answerphone,” after which they sustained club momentum through joint releases with Sean Paul, Rêve, Ella Eyre, and additional collaborators.

The pair came together in 2014, uniting the skills of studio specialists KNY Factory and Soke. Their earliest material consisted of electronic reinterpretations of landmark reggae recordings by Bob Marley, Sizzla, and Capelton. Only with the 2017 single “LIT” did Banx & Ranx debut original material, extending the trap-accented rhythms they had previously layered onto reggae productions by other artists. Steady behind-the-scenes activity followed, encompassing remixes and production credits for Gorillaz, Sean Paul, David Guetta, and further acts, all preceding the 2018 arrival of “Answerphone.” That track reached number five in the U.K. and paved the way for subsequent releases: the 2018 cut “Ego” featuring Sean Paul, the 2019 song “Mama” with Ella Eyre and Kiana Ledé, and the 2022 track “Headphones” alongside Rêve and Tommy Genesis.
